Output 6548115b0b4d36c2a6577867d0e92e5826706301dc191ea91e2ba8d68a6eee68:17

value
17090202
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08f95030cf8c8f82db2a76f1b87ca01d21cdf8af OP_EQUALVERIFY OP_CHECKSIG
address
LL3QLLRBJwDcZ9gfByjtUVixUDZ7WHFZ9h
transaction
6548115b0b4d36c2a6577867d0e92e5826706301dc191ea91e2ba8d68a6eee68
spent
true